    Hi

    I have a charge on my credit card from a car rental company. It's not for a big amount (only about €25) that I want to get back.

    I emailed them 4 times already and sent them proof that I shouldn't have received a charge. They also haven't told me what the charge was for.

    Anyway, all I could see after a quick google on how to do this was a PDF to print and fill in. Can I start chargeback proceedings electronically or over the phone?

    Thanks

    Hi cloneslad, 

    Thanks for contacting us on Boards. 

    To request a chargeback for this transaction, it's necessary to fill in the Chargeback form you mention, as it is not possible to request it over the phone or online. You can find this Chargeback form on our website here
